The cheapest way to get from Corby to Elton is to bus which costs £3 and takes 42 min.
The fastest way to get from Corby to Elton is to taxi which takes 25 min and costs £35 - £45.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from (Corby) Railway Station Forecourt station and arriving at Middle Street. Services depart hourly,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 42 min.
The distance between Corby and Elton is 21 miles. The road distance is 16.4 miles.
The best way to get from Corby to Elton without a car is to bus which takes 42 min and costs £3.
The bus from (Corby) Railway Station Forecourt to Middle Street takes 42 min including transfers and departs hourly.
Corby to Elton bus services, operated by Stagecoach Midlands, depart from (Corby) Railway Station Forecourt.
Corby to Elton bus services, operated by Stagecoach Midlands, arrive at Middle Street station.
Yes, the driving distance between Corby to Elton is 16 miles. It takes approximately 25 min to drive from Corby to Elton.
